上一页 1 ··· 3 4 5 6 7 8 下一页

2012年2月22日

bash 学习笔记2

摘要: 大文件切分:fedoraspilt -b 10m sourceFile desPrefix小文件合并:cat sourceFile1 sourceFile2 ....>destFile 阅读全文

posted @ 2012-02-22 13:49 萌@宇 阅读(128) 评论(0) 推荐(0) 编辑

2012年2月21日

多机共用同一键盘鼠标

摘要: 机器多了自然控制就麻烦了,要用不同的键盘,使用多个鼠标,十分不爽,还好有synergy,帮助我们摆脱这恼人的情形。 简单的说synergy做的就是将各个不同系统的机器通过安装synergy程序,使用client-server模式,来共享一个键盘鼠标。项目是开源的,主页是http://synergy-foss.org/。 下面说明一下使用说明: (1)首先从官网上下载对应系统的安装程序,windows很简单,直接安装就好。我的client使用的fedora 15,下载rpm包,在安装之前,需要安装qt依赖包,使用sudo yum install qt qt-x11 即可。 (2)启... 阅读全文

posted @ 2012-02-21 23:40 萌@宇 阅读(522) 评论(0) 推荐(0) 编辑

web.py 安装问题

摘要: 搞python的web框架,通过python安装web.py报错,记录一下错误:File "setup.py", line 6, in ? from web import __version__ File "/home/yanhui.jy/webpy/web.py-0.36/web/__init__.py", line 27, in ? from application import * File "/home/yanhui.jy/webpy/web.py-0.36/web/application.py", line 639 SUFF 阅读全文

posted @ 2012-02-21 16:04 萌@宇 阅读(454) 评论(0) 推荐(0) 编辑

bash 学习笔记1

摘要: · ’ “ 的区别·即键盘左上角esc键下面。在bash中· ·中间的脚本会进行执行,同样的如$()也会执行内部的语句如line=`wc -l<deploy/master `会执行wc -l <deploy/master并把值赋给line变量。单引号和双引号的区别:单引号不会将引号内部的\"$进行解析。如上面的echo '$line',结果是$line双引号会将内部的\"$进行解析,上面的echo "$line"结果是文件正确行数。if的String test如下:if [ " 阅读全文

posted @ 2012-02-21 11:57 萌@宇 阅读(132) 评论(0) 推荐(0) 编辑

2012年2月19日

bash学习笔记

摘要: bash程序书写规范:1、The header2、Global declarations3、Sanity checks4、The main script5、Clean up 阅读全文

posted @ 2012-02-19 16:06 萌@宇 阅读(167) 评论(0) 推荐(0) 编辑

2012年2月18日

bash 中覆写当前处理的文件

摘要: 工作中需要处理将大量的java文件中一个资源文件位置变更,编写一个简单的bash脚本,采用sed替换,但是采用sed 's//' test.java > test.java时候,test.java消失,查了一下,有一下的解决方法,采用tmp文件进行复写。#! /bin/bashwhile read linedo if grep "sessionTimeOut = conf.getInt(\"zookeeper.session.timeout\", 180000);" $line then echo $line match sed & 阅读全文

posted @ 2012-02-18 18:38 萌@宇 阅读(257) 评论(0) 推荐(0) 编辑

2012年2月16日

bash 中 while读取文件并通过 ssh执行命令出现的问题及解决方法

摘要: 最近在做一些集群管理的简单脚本,其中有一部分是将文件中的机器名读取,并将应用通过scp传输,通过ssh解压部署。#! /bin/bashwhile read IPdoscp adfs-*.tar.gz $IP:~ssh $IP tar -zxf adfs-*.tar.gzdone<machine 一开始写了个简单的脚本,通过machine读取所有机器名,在进行操作。 可是运行以后发现,只有第一次循环成功运行,剩下的都没有运行。 google了一下,是由于bash中while循环调用ssh后会使用subshell,导致后续操作无法进行。 解决方法为在ssh上加参数-n,即可成功运行。... 阅读全文

posted @ 2012-02-16 14:37 萌@宇 阅读(651) 评论(0) 推荐(0) 编辑

2012年1月29日

学习计划 2-3月

摘要: 制定学习计划:2-3月 python <<beginning python>> <<pro python>>2-3月 Hadoop 源码分析,找基线版本每晚分析代码 阅读全文

posted @ 2012-01-29 11:43 萌@宇 阅读(140) 评论(0) 推荐(0) 编辑

2011年12月6日

Hadoop HA 学习

摘要: Hadoop HA是一个非常需要重视的问题。众所周知,Haddop是一个SPOF(single point of failure)系统,存在单点问题。对于7×24生产环境,是具有极大的风险。 目前社区版的做法是有两种保障机制,第一种是可以设置一个NFS的目录,存储fsimage和editlog,存储的是实时数据,这样当namenode挂掉后能够通过fsimage和editlog进行完全恢复。第二种是设置secondary namenode,名称很迷惑,但其作用是对fsimage和editlog进行定期的merge,默认是5分钟,所以获得的数据是过期的,存在数据丢失,但是能够恢复大部分 阅读全文

posted @ 2011-12-06 11:31 萌@宇 阅读(1163) 评论(0) 推荐(0) 编辑

2011年10月31日

fedora 启动 openssh

摘要: 记录一下。fedora手动启动openssh server方法: sudo /etc/init.d/sshd start 需要sudo权限 阅读全文

posted @ 2011-10-31 16:23 萌@宇 阅读(180) 评论(0) 推荐(0) 编辑

上一页 1 ··· 3 4 5 6 7 8 下一页

导航